Falk admires Imam's personality

The late founder of the Islamic Republic, Imam Khomeini was one of the strongest human presences that I have ever experienced, former UN rapporteur in Palestinian human rights, Richard Falk told the Qods News Agency (Qodsna).

“The dark sparkle of his eyes and the sharp focus of his mind were particularly vivid and memorable for me,” he said, recounting his meeting with Imam Khomeini in January 1979.

The American personality said in the meeting, Imam Khomeini was very clear that Jews were welcome in the Islamic Republic of Iran provided that they did not have an involvement with Israel as had been the case during the rule of the Shah for some leading members of the Jewish community.

"Judaism is an authentic religion," Falk quoted the Imam as saying, adding the Imam favored a just solution of the status of Palestine by by which to end the Zionist insistence on 'a Jewish state' but not necessarily the end of a Jewish residence.

Asked about the US position in the case of the ISIL terror group, the American personality said there is no doubt that the US occupation policies in Iraq created some of the conditions that led to the emergence of the terror group.
